Commercial Description:
Gently bitter, deliciously mild – manufactured using a special process to preserve the natural flavour.
Our Original Alkoholfrei (Original Non-Alcoholic) is low in calories and easy on the digestion. Its isotonic properties make it the ideal refreshment after exercise.
